Energy Saving Tips: Ways To Save Energy

Here are some ways you can save energy and help in the better conservation of the atmosphere. Saving energy can reduce the risk of global warming! Here are some cool tips to save energy in your day today life.
 
The world today faces an acute shortage of energy and the day won't be long when mankind would have to face an energy crisis! The dwindling fossil fuels and lack of an environment friendly fuel alternative are the two main causes of concern when one talks about energy saving. It thus becomes an urgent need for everyone to start saving energy lest one may feel powerless! The best and foremost way to start saving energy is from one's own home. It has been reported that the yearly home utility bill of an US family is over $1,600 and from this fact one can see how people have been careless about saving energy. Saving energy would not only help in the better protection of the environment but would also save money for many families around the world.

There are many ways in which one can start saving energy at home and one of the ways is to make wise and thoughtful choices while tuning on and off the light in your home. The first step in saving energy would be simply to turn on the lights when one really needs them and turning them off when not needed. It is not only the cars and other vehicles that add up to huge carbon dioxide emissions in the atmosphere but even a modern house can pollute the environment with its unrestrained use of energy.

Ways to Save Energy at Home
In most of the modern homes there are heating, and cooling system that consume a lot of energy and if one puts a check on the use of these systems energy saving would be significant. In order to have better cooling and heating of your home one should check for the insulation of walls and ducts from which unnecessary heat might escape putting extra strain over the heating and cooling devices. When the thermostat is set down only by one centigrade you can save up to 10% on the monthly utility bill. When one makes energy efficient changes in home one can also hope for a better resale value of the home.
Save Energy in Home Appliances
Home appliances like television, DVD players, and the like should be turned off because even when they are in standby mode these devices keep on consuming energy. When one uses a dishwasher the washed dishes should be dried in the open air rather than using the dishwasher's drying facility. Instead of using the regular electric bulb one can go in for a fluorescent light bulb that are low in energy consumption but still give required amount of light in rooms. If one is using the hot water tank then insulation for it is a must and the insulating jacket could save you many dollars in your monthly utility bills. Sensible use of water in the house also helps in saving energy because most of the electricity goes in pumping water to many homes in a city.
Easy Tips for Energy Saving
In order to save energy and water one can see if there are no leaking taps in the bathroom if there are any one should replace them as early as possible. Taking shorter showers is another great way to save energy and water. For warming up food one can use the microwave instead of a stove because a microwave consumes 50% less energy than a regular heating appliances.
Many people are also careless with their refrigerators and think that keeping the refrigerator door open doesn't mean wasting energy. However, the truth is that if a refrigerator door is kept open the cooling system of machine needs to use a lot of electricity in order to keep things cool and this certainly adds to extra consumption of energy. The refrigerator door should work like a complete seal and for this its rubber gasket should be in good condition.
